The performance of the Colorful iGame GeForce RTX 5070 Ti Ultra Z OC is driven by a base GPU clock speed of 2295 MHz and a turbo boost up to 2497 MHz, providing high-speed rendering and processing. It achieves a pixel rate of 239.7 GPixel/s and a texture rate of 699.2 GTexels/s, ensuring smooth visuals and efficient texture handling. With a floating-point performance of 44.75 TFLOPS, the card is capable of handling complex calculations and tasks with ease. It also features 8960 shading units, 280 texture mapping units, and 96 render output units, further enhancing its computational capabilities. Additionally, the GPU supports Double Precision Floating Point (DPFP), making it well-suited for high-accuracy calculations.
The Colorful iGame GeForce RTX 5070 Ti Ultra Z OC is equipped with 16GB of GDDR7 VRAM and an effective memory speed of 28000 MHz, providing high-speed memory for demanding tasks. It delivers a maximum memory bandwidth of 896 GB/s and has a 256-bit memory bus width, ensuring fast data transfer. The card also supports ECC memory, which helps maintain data integrity by detecting and correcting errors during use.
The Colorful iGame GeForce RTX 5070 Ti Ultra Z OC comes with a range of advanced features designed for enhanced performance. It supports DirectX 12 Ultimate and OpenGL 4.6, ensuring compatibility with the latest gaming and creative applications. The card also supports ray tracing for more realistic graphics, along with DLSS for improved performance in supported games. With multi-display technology support, it can drive up to 4 displays, and it even includes RGB lighting for a customizable aesthetic.
The Colorful iGame GeForce RTX 5070 Ti Ultra Z OC offers a variety of display connectivity options. It includes 1 HDMI 2.1b port and 3 DisplayPort outputs, enabling multiple display setups. However, it does not feature USB-C, DVI, or mini DisplayPort outputs, making it focused on HDMI and DisplayPort connections for high-quality visuals.
The Colorful iGame GeForce RTX 5070 Ti Ultra Z OC is powered by the Blackwell GPU architecture and has a 300W TDP, requiring a robust power supply for optimal performance. It uses PCI Express 5.0, offering high-speed data transfer, and is built with a 5 nm semiconductor size, featuring 45.6 billion transistors. While it does not include air-water cooling, it has a compact form factor with a width of 300.5 mm and a height of 120 mm.
